Output 04d581526e230df1ab6a78cf0a82d820cb3a4a0093abc4380407ca568f015dc4:1

value
1104960
script pubkey
OP_0 OP_PUSHBYTES_20 58150199ce5c8add515f7a99d80c56e714d657b6
address
ltc1qtq2srxwwtj9d652l02vasrzkuu2dv4akaugsff
transaction
04d581526e230df1ab6a78cf0a82d820cb3a4a0093abc4380407ca568f015dc4
spent
true